Based on a person’s needs and understanding both the physical and emotional challenges of recovery, MAT is often the foundation of our treatment approach based on the individual's struggles and clinical assessment. Offering FDA-approved medications like Suboxone (a combination of buprenorphine and naloxone) to alleviate withdrawal symptoms, reduce cravings, and stabilize the body can significantly improve the ability to maintain recovery. By supporting physical recovery, MAT allows patients to focus on rebuilding their lives and addressing the deeper aspects of addiction. Suboxone also includes safeguards against misuse, promoting long-term success. We believe that lasting recovery requires more than medication. That’s why we pair MAT with personalized counseling services, tailored to meet the unique aspects of each person we serve. Through therapeutic intervention, we address the root causes of addiction, provide emotional support, and teach practical tools and skills to navigate challenges along the way.
